Napatree Capital LLC Makes New Investment in Vanguard Short-Term Treasury Index ETF (NASDAQ:VGSH)

Napatree Capital LLC acquired a new position in shares of Vanguard Short-Term Treasury Index ETF (NASDAQ:VGSHFree Report) during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or acquired 3,791 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$221,000.

Vanguard Short-Term Treasury Index ETF Increases Dividend

The firm also recently declared a monthly dividend, which was paid on Wednesday, June 5th. Shareholders of record on Monday, June 3rd were paid a $0.206 dividend. This is a positive change from Vanguard Short-Term Treasury Index ETF’s previous monthly dividend of $0.20. This represents a $2.47 annualized dividend and a yield of 4.27%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, June 3rd.

Vanguard Short-Term Treasury Index ETF Company Profile

(Free Report)

Vanguard Short Term Government Bond ETF (the Fund) seeks to track the performance of a market-weighted government bond index with a short-term, dollar-weighted average maturity.
